Types of Lockable Mailboxes
Wall-Mounted Lockable Mailboxes: These mailboxes were installed on the exterior wall of your property or building. Great for homes with limited space and provide easy access for mail delivery and retrieval.

Post-Mounted Lockable Mailboxes: These mailboxes are installed on a post, typically after a driveway or nearby the entrance of your property. They may be larger than wall-mounted mailboxes and can accommodate more mail and packages.

Parcel Lockable Mailboxes: Designed specifically for receiving larger packages, these mailboxes possess a secure compartment that may hold parcels. Perfect for those who frequently receive online orders or larger items.

Column-Mounted Lockable Mailboxes: These mailboxes are designed into a column or pedestal, providing a fashionable and secure option. They are often used in gated communities or upscale residences.

Cluster Box Units (CBUs): Commonly used in apartment complexes and community mail areas, CBUs have multiple lockable compartments within a single unit. Each resident includes a separate locked compartment for his or her mail.

Key Features to consider in a Lockable Mailbox
Durable Construction: Try to find mailboxes created from high-quality, durable materials including stainless steel, galvanized steel, or heavy-duty plastic. These materials are resistance against weather and tampering.

Secure Locking Mechanism: The lock is a crucial component of a lockable mailbox. Opt for mailboxes with high-quality locks, such as cam locks, combination locks, or electronic keypads. Ensure the lock is resistant against picking and drilling.

Adequate Size: Select a mailbox that's large enough to support your regular mail and then any small packages you might receive. Think about your typical mail volume and also the types of things you receive.

Weather Resistance: Try to find mailboxes with weather-resistant features including sealed seams, water-resistant coatings, and covered mail slots. These characteristics protect your mail from rain, snow, as well as other weather conditions.

Quick and easy installation: Consider the installation requirements with the mailbox. Some mailboxes are really easy to install with basic tools, although some may require professional installation. Select one that suits your DIY skills and installation preferences.

Visual appeal: While security will be the main priority, the look off the mailbox can be important. Pick a design and handle that complements the outside of your home and enhances its entrance charm.

Tips for Deciding on the best Lockable Mailbox
Assess Your requirements: Consider the volume and kind of mail you obtain, as well as the location in which you will install the mailbox. This should help you determine the size and type of mailbox that best suits your needs.

Set a Budget: Lockable mailboxes come in a range of prices. Set a budget and look for mailboxes offering the best mix of security, durability, and aesthetics that isn't too expensive.

Read Reviews: Research and study reviews using their company customers to gauge the standard and performance of various mailbox models. Reviews can provide valuable insights into the pros and cons of specific mailboxes.

Check Local Regulations: Ensure that the mailbox you decide on complies with local postal regulations and guidelines. Almost all of the important for post-mounted and cluster box units.

Consider Characteristics: Some lockable mailboxes include extra features for example outgoing mail compartments, newspaper holders, and integrated lighting. Consider whether these features would be beneficial for your needs.
